People in #SouthSudan are facing growing barriers to medical care, according to our new report:Left behind in crisis: Escalating violence and healthcare collapse in South Sudan With a lack of funding for health services, rising violence, and overlapping crises, the situation in the country is catastrophic. Here’s a glimpse of the current humanitarian crisis: 🔴 Eight attacks on our staff and facilities have occurred in 2025 alone. 🔴 One mother laboured for three days because the maternity ward lost 54 staff when funding disappeared. Tragically, her baby did not survive. 🔴 Ministry of Health staff treat around 900 patients a week, often without a salary that can support their families. Doctors Without Borders warn the urgent needs in South Sudan demand coordinated action, renewed international commitment and genuine solidarity. The world cannot turn away at this critical moment.
